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29829928966 22390 0853814425 4150349703
273507917 64533774 01
273507917 64533774 01
093 42272035 5951 2311186
All about undefined
Interested in learning more?
273507917 64533774 01
093 42272035 5951 2311186
See more
12 65 32
32136810 46 3866795426 818049
See more
15766 4632517
5083076 63250 928 01094197
See more